Suits for Obligations Clause Samples

Suits for Obligations. Nothing in this Section 7.4, in any other provision of this Agreement or in any of the Transaction Documents shall affect or impair the right of the Secured Parties to enforce against any Obligor after the occurrence and during the continuance of an Event of Default, any obligation to pay principal, interest, make-whole amount, fees and any other amounts under (and in accordance with the terms of) the Transaction Documents to which such Obligor is a party, and any other obligations thereunder, and to accept and retain payment in respect of any such obligations or to enforce against any other Obligor of such obligations any right to have such Obligor make such payment and to accept and retain payment from such obligor in respect of any such obligations, provided that none of the Notes shall be declared immediately due and payable except in accordance with Section 12 of the Note Purchase and Participation Agreement and nothing in this sentence shall affect, limit, impair or reduce the requirements of Section 7.5, Section 7.8 or Section 4 herein with respect to the disposition of, and sharing of, Collateral and proceeds of Collateral received by a Secured Party or paid to a Secured Party by any Obligor or any other obligor. Nothing in this Section 7.4, in any other provision of this Agreement or in any of the Transaction Documents shall affect or impair the obligation of any Guarantor under the Note Purchase and Participation Agreement or any other guarantor with respect to any guaranty that may be issued in respect of all or any of the Secured Obligations, whether such guaranty is to pay the indebtedness relating to the Secured Obligations or to satisfy each other undertaking with respect thereto.
